Comprehending Bifold Doors
Bifold doors include 2 panels that fold against each other. These doors can be made from various materials, including wood, aluminum, or glass, and are typically utilized as an alternative to traditional swinging doors. While bifold doors offer special advantages, they can encounter several concerns in time.
Typical Issues with Bifold DoorsConcernDescriptionMisalignmentDoors may not line up properly due to settling, warping, or use.Broken hingesHarmed or used hinges can result in doors being unable to open/close.Jammed tracksDirt, debris, or damage can obstruct the door's movement in its track.Harmed panelsFractures, chips, or fogging in glass panels can detract from looks and security.Weatherproofing failureIneffective seals can cause drafts and water leak.Repair Processes
The process for repairing bifold door trouble doors differs based on the particular problem at hand. Here, we break down the steps for attending to some common issues:
1. Misalignment Repair
Misaligned bifold doors can impact both functionality and security. To fix this concern:
Assessment: Inspect the door's hinges and frame.Adjustment: Loosen the hinge screws, straighten the panels, and re-tighten the screws.Shimming: Add or get rid of shims in the hinges if necessary to accomplish correct positioning.2. Broken Hinges
Hinge breakdown can paralyze the efficiency of bifold doors:
Removal: Unscrew the broken hinge.Replacement: Install a new hinge or repair the existing one utilizing a hinge package.Checking: Ensure the door opens and closes efficiently after repairs.3. Track Cleaning and Repair
Keeping tracks devoid of obstruction is crucial for door performance:
Cleaning: Remove dirt and particles using a vacuum or brush.Examination: Look for bends or breaks in the track.Repair: Straighten or replace damaged tracks to make sure appropriate door movement.4. Panel Damage Repair
For instance, a split glass panel needs instant attention to keep security:
Replacement: Carefully eliminate the damaged panel and replace it with a brand-new one.Crisis Management: If waiting for a replacement, use weather-resistant plastic to cover the panel temporarily.5. Weatherproofing Fixes
To enhance the barriers against components:
Seal Replacement: Inspect the rubber seals for damage and replace if essential.Adjustment: Ensure that the door closes securely versus the seals to remove air flow.Cost Considerations
The cost associated with bifold door repairs can differ considerably based on the nature of the problem and the materials utilized. Below is a breakdown of typical costs associated with repairs:
Repair TypeEstimated Cost RangeMisalignment₤ 75 - ₤ 150Broken Hinges₤ 50 - ₤ 120 per hingeTrack Cleaning₤ 50 - ₤ 100Panel Replacement₤ 150 - ₤ 400Weatherproofing₤ 30 - ₤ 100Total Estimated Cost₤ 200 - ₤ 700
Keep in mind: Costs can differ by area and specific service suppliers. Constantly look for multiple quotes when asking for repairs.
Maintenance Tips for Bifold Doors
Preventing future repairs is always more affordable than resolving them after the fact. Routine maintenance can help extend the lifespan of your bifold doors.
Regular Cleaning: Clean the tracks and panels frequently to prevent dirt build-up.Lubrication: Apply lube to hinges and tracks quarterly to make sure smooth operation.Examine Regularly: Conduct regular evaluations of hinges, seals, and panels to capture issues early.Weather condition Sealing: Replace damaged seals immediately to maintain energy performance.Inform Staff: Train personnel to use bifold doors correctly to prevent unnecessary strain and damage.FAQs
